Relates to #148.

If the menu bar icon is hidden (such as when behind the notch, or otherwise), reopening the app will display an alert that the icon is hidden.
There's also a button to not show the alert again.

I've also tested that this, and the 'Do not show again' button, work in a fresh VM.

This is the same as what Tailscale does:
